Looks like the price war on the kangaroo route could be coming to an end:

Emirates to raise fares out of Australia

Emirates airline will increase fares for all cabin classes on its flights out of Australia starting Thursday, according to a spokesperson.

While the airline did not divulge the percentage increase in fares, according to a report published yesterday in Sydney Morning Herald, the company would increase fares by seven per cent.
